I got mine equally as muddy over Memorial Day weekend.  3 easy steps can take care of it though

1. Pressure Wash it
2. Mr. Clean Carwash it
3. Polish it your self.

I had a couple new pinstrips on mine when I got done cleaning it. I hit them with a buffer at about 2k RPM and compound and they came out quickly.  However mine is Pewter and buffs out nicely and is very forgiving.  Black is the most unforgiving color that you will find when it comes to polishing.
